Citigroup says CFO John Gerspach’s salary was increased to $500K from $400K. James Forese, co-head of global markets, will now make $475,000, more than double the $225,000 he previously earned. The new salaries fall within the guidelines issued by the Obama administration’s pay czar, Kenneth Feinberg.
